A Life Well Lived

Audrey died peacefully at home on the morning of September 29 in the company of caregivers and loved ones. She was a woman of strong faith. At the age of 97 she was ready to go. Her work here was done - for children with cancer, for families who found a home away from home in Ronald McDonald Houses around the world, and for the children being educated and nurtured at the St. James School in Philadelphia. Audrey did not want to be remembered for her many awards and accomplishments. She wanted to be remembered as a woman who cared. Because she cared, the world is a better place. How blessed we were to know her!
